Benchmark Reaffirms Buy Rating for Dave (NASDAQ:DAVE)

Benchmark restated their buy rating on shares of Dave (NASDAQ:DAVEFree Report) in a research report released on Wednesday, Marketbeat Ratings reports. Benchmark currently has a $320.00 price target on the fintech company’s stock.

A number of other analysts have also recently weighed in on DAVE. Barrington Research reissued an “outperform” rating and set a $290.00 price objective on shares of Dave in a report on Monday, August 18th. Wall Street Zen cut shares of Dave from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Saturday, August 9th. Citizens Jmp lifted their target price on shares of Dave from $280.00 to $300.00 and gave the company a “mkt outperform” rating in a report on Friday, September 26th. BMO Capital Markets reaffirmed an “outperform” rating on shares of Dave in a report on Tuesday, June 10th. Finally, JMP Securities lifted their target price on shares of Dave from $280.00 to $300.00 and gave the company a “market outperform” rating in a report on Friday, September 26th. Eight invest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and two have issued a Hold r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us target price of $274.13.

Dave Stock Down 0.4%

DAVE stock opened at $203.43 on Wednesday. The company has a current ratio of 9.51, a quick ratio of 9.51 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.35. Dave has a twelve month low of $37.44 and a twelve month high of $286.45. The company’s 50 day moving average is $211.18 and its two-hundred day moving average is $178.93. The stock has a market cap of $2.75 billion, a P/E ratio of 53.82 and a beta of 3.88.

Dave declared that its Board of Directors has approved a share repurchase plan on Wednesday, August 13th that allows the company to repurchase $125.00 million in outstanding shares. This repurchase authorization allows the fintech company to purchase up to 5.1%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ares repurchase plans are often a sign that the company’s board of directors believes its stock is undervalued.

About Dave

Dave, Inc is a digital banking service. Its products include a budgeting tool to help members manage their upcoming bills to avoid overspending, cash advances through its flagship ExtraCash product to help members avoid punitive overdraft fees, a Side Hustle product, where Dave helps connect members with supplemental work opportunities, and Dave Banking, a modern checking account experience with valuable tools for building long-term financial health.
